motor cubicles / cabinets
Since you appear to be dealing with flight simulators, do you not think this might not refer to the control cubicles (containing all the switches, relays, and electronics) for electric motors that make the simulator pitch and roll, simulate acceleration, etc.?
That said, I don't know to what extent motors are used for this, and how much is hydraulic ...
